Engineering The Perfect Pilates Garment: Material Science & Structural Differences

While yoga apparel focuses heavily on soft stretch and static holding, Pilates wear demands engineered support structures that dynamic core movements and reformer equipment interaction necessitate. Sourcing agencies must evaluate factory outputs using key technical requirements:

1. Hardware-Free Design (Anti-Abrasive Panels)
Pilates practitioners spend considerable time on wooden and leather reformers. Sourcing teams should instruct factories to avoid exposed zippers, metal toggles, and harsh eyelets. These elements scratch reformer beds and pinch the skin during supine positions. Flatlock stitching is the industry gold standard.

2. Compression Gradient Mapping
Pilates exercises focus on core stabilization. Garments with target-mapped compression around the transversus abdominis and lower back provide subtle tactile biofeedback, guiding the wearer to maintain alignment and engage the core.

3. High-Density Interlock Knitting (Non-See-Through Guarantee)
Sourcing specifications must mandate dual-knit interlock structures of at least 220 GSM to ensure 100% opacity during flexion, hamstring extensions, and overhead stretches.

Macro Sourcing Solutions & Factory Audit Framework

B2B procurement professionals must run exhaustive risk mitigation checks during the factory selection phase. Use the following framework to assess capability, environmental compliance, and supply chain security:

Sustainability Auditing

Brands should require Global Recycled Standard (GRS) and OEKO-TEX Standard 100 verification. Sourcing recycled nylon made from ocean waste or post-industrial waste has shifted from a marketing feature to a basic compliance standard.

Digital Design (ODM/OEM)

Inquire if the supplier uses 3D rendering (e.g., CLO 3D or Browzwear) to create digital samples. This reduces sample turnaround times from weeks to days, saving costs and material waste during prototype feedback cycles.

Seamless Production Capacity

Verify that the factory utilizes high-grade circular knitting machines (such as Santoni machinery) for seamless garments, which are highly preferred in professional Pilates lines to eliminate chafing.

Navigating Customs, Tariffs, and Regulatory Audits

Delivering high-end Pilates apparel safely and cost-effectively requires solid understanding of global customs framework. Key parameters include:

  • HS Code Standardization: Verify that garments are correctly classified (e.g., HS Code 6109.90 for synthetic knit tops and HS Code 6104.63 for synthetic knit trousers/leggings) to prevent miscalculated duty charges.
  • EPR Laws Compliance: Extended Producer Responsibility regulations in European countries (e.g., France, Germany) mandate registration for packaging and textile recycling schemes.
  • Forced Labor and Trade Compliance: Factories must maintain clear, verified raw material chains (from fiber to fabric to finished garment) to pass inspections like the U.S. Uyghur Forced Labor Prevention Act (UFLPA) audit.

Sourcing Pro-Tip

Always request a Certificate of Origin (CO) and testing reports covering formaldehyde content, heavy metals, pH levels, and color fastness before bulk shipments release from the factory warehouse. Partnering with testing providers like SGS or Intertek ensures smooth clearance.

What is the typical Minimum Order Quantity (MOQ) for custom Pilates apparel factories?
MOQs vary based on design personalization. For custom colors and custom-developed fabrics, MOQs typically range from 500 to 1,000 pieces per color/style. However, many factories offer lower MOQs (e.g., 100 to 200 pieces) for in-stock, standard-knit fabrics using custom silicone or heat-transfer logos.
How do you guarantee the leggings are 100% squat-proof during production?
To ensure leggings are non-see-through, request factories use an interlock knit method rather than a single-jersey structure. You should specify a fabric weight of at least 220-250 GSM and demand stretch-recovery tests. Buyers can request a physical test sample to verify opacity under full-stretch light box conditions.
What is the standard production lead time for bulk orders?
For initial bulk orders, design and sample approvals typically take 7-15 days. Bulk production takes approximately 30-45 days after the pre-production sample (PPS) is confirmed. Repeat orders can often be expedited to 25-30 days when fabrics are kept in stock.
Why is nylon preferred over polyester in professional Pilates wear?
Nylon is softer, possesses superior abrasion resistance, and offers better elasticity than polyester. Polyester is widely used in general sports because of its low cost, but nylon provides a premium skin feel, lower static cling, and improved shape recovery. These properties make nylon ideal for the high friction and stretching movements typical in Pilates.
How do you implement quality control for international bulk shipments?
Experienced factories follow an AQL (Acceptable Quality Limit) 2.5 quality control standard. We recommend requesting third-party inspections at the factory (during inline production and pre-shipment). The inspectors will check stitching tolerances, seam elasticity, grading size compliance, and packaging.
